From a vessel of 45 liters which is full of milk, 9 liters milk is taken out and completely replaced with water. Again 9 liters mixture is taken out and completely replaced with water. Find the quantity of milk left in the final mixture?

  1. 32.4 liters
  2. 28.8 liters
  3. 24 liters
  4. 33.6 liters

Correct answer: 28.8 liters

Solution

After each replacement, the fraction of milk remaining = (45-9)/45 = 36/45 = 4/5. After 2 replacements: milk = 45 × (4/5)² = 45 × 16/25 = 28.8 liters.
